Complexation of aqueous ammonia by cyclodextrins

Warren M. HirschCarol DiMartiniV. FriedWilliam Y. Ling

Year: 1987 Journal:   Canadian Journal of Chemistry Vol: 65 (11)Pages: 2661-2664   Publisher: NRC Research Press

Abstract

The complexation of aqueous ammonia with α, β, and γ cyclodextrins has been monitored by pH measurements at (23 ± 1) °C. A mathematical model has been developed yielding reproducible equilibrium association constants for the formation of these complexes. The constants are quite large, suggesting the possibility of hydrogen bond formation.
